BRRRR Method Downfall

Chris Mandle
  • Investor
Posted

Curious if anyone out there as something bad to say about BRRRR or did not have success and has some experience on some pitfalls to look out for before starting? Thanks!

@Chris Mandle I can't tell you to read my comprehensive BRRRR Sucks blog post because it references our website...its a shame because it might be the best BRRRR article ever written...maybe I'll go in and remove the link...

Anyway, the BRRRR strategy is the cause of many investors downfall...1 deal and done. Its an advanced strategy that only works in select parts of the country...or locations where you can buy property for .50 on the dollar. There's a lot more to this, but BRRRR can be very dangerous...if folks were honest, there would be an entire forum dedicated to failed BRRRR deals.
